#
351207 |
|
19-Aug-2019 |
avg |
MFC r350701,r350702: rc.8: add a reference to service(8)
|
#
344068 |
|
12-Feb-2019 |
ngie |
MFC r342598:
Remove legacy rc.d infrastructure references from rc(8)
Legacy rc.d scripts (.sh extension) have not been supported since r193118. Remove the outdated references to the legacy format, as they are no longer valid.
PR: 193936 Approved by: jtl (mentor) Differential Revision: https://reviews.freebsd.org/D19157
|
#
340966 |
|
26-Nov-2018 |
eugen |
MFC r339818: rcorder(8):
Add support for /etc/rc.resume, so it calls "rcorder -k resume" and runs scripts containing "KEYWORD: resume" with single "resume" argument.
Working example is the port sysutils/cpupdate that defines extra_commands="resume" to reload CPU microcode cleared by suspend/resume sequence.
This change does nothing for a system having no scripts with KEYWORD: resume.
PR: 227866 Differential Revision: https://reviews.freebsd.org/D15247
|
#
325052 |
|
28-Oct-2017 |
se |
MFC 324721: Add references to sysrc(8) to SEE ALSO. MFC 324823: Mention sysrc(8) as scripting interface for config files.
|
#
302408 |
|
07-Jul-2016 |
gjb |
Copy head@r302406 to stable/11 as part of the 11.0-RELEASE cycle. Prune svn:mergeinfo from the new branch, as nothing has been merged here.
Additional commits post-branch will follow.
Approved by: re (implicit) Sponsored by: The FreeBSD Foundation |
#
298517 |
|
23-Apr-2016 |
bapt |
Bump the date of the manpage after r298515
Sponsored by: Essen Hackathon 2016
|
#
298515 |
|
23-Apr-2016 |
lme |
- Add two new subcommands to rc.subr: "describe" shows an rc script's description "extracommands" shows an rc script's non-standard commands like "reload", "configtest", "keygen", etc - Update the rc(8) manpage and the tcsh(1) completion examples to reflect these changes
Approved by: bapt Sponsored by: Essen Linuxhotel Hackathon 2016 Differential Revision: D452
|
#
276263 |
|
26-Dec-2014 |
bapt |
Sort SEE ALSO
|
#
263142 |
|
14-Mar-2014 |
eadler |
multiple: Remove 3rd clause from BSD license where approved by the regents and renumber.
This patch skips files in contrib/ and crypto/
Acked by: imp Discussed with: emaste
|
#
259879 |
|
25-Dec-2013 |
pluknet |
Clean up manual pages after BIND removal.
MFC after: 1 week
|
#
256775 |
|
19-Oct-2013 |
cperciva |
Add support for "first boot" rc.d scripts. [1]
These scripts, containing # KEYWORD: firstboot will only be run if a sentinel file (default: /firstboot, configurable via the rc.conf ${firstboot_sentinel} variable) exists; this sentinel file will be deleted at the end of the boot process.
Scripts can request that the system reboot after the first boot by creating the file ${firstboot_sentinel}-reboot.
This functionality is expected to be useful for embedded systems and virtual machine images, where it may be desirable to (a) download and install updates which became available between when the image was created and when it was "turned on"; (b) download and install packages which may be newer than those which were available when the image was created; (c) install packages which run binaries during their install process, bypassing the problem of cross-architecture installs; (d) resize filesystems to match the disk onto which a VM image was installed; (e) perform initialization tasks relevant to cloud systems (e.g., Amazon's Elastic Compute Cloud); and likely to perform many other one-time initialization functions.
Document this new functionality in rc.conf(5) and rc(8). [2]
Reviewed by: freebsd-current, freebsd-rc [1] Reviewed by: Warren Block [2] MFC after: 3 days
|
#
255809 |
|
23-Sep-2013 |
des |
Add a setup script for unbound(8) called local-unbound-setup. It generates a configuration suitable for running unbound as a caching forwarding resolver, and configures resolvconf(8) to update unbound's list of forwarders in addition to /etc/resolv.conf. The initial list is taken from the existing resolv.conf, which is rewritten to point to localhost. Alternatively, a list of forwarders can be provided on the command line.
To assist this script, add an rc.subr command called "enabled" which does nothing except return 0 if the service is enabled and 1 if it is not, without going through the usual checks. We should consider doing the same for "status", which is currently pointless.
Add an rc script for unbound, called local_unbound. If there is no configuration file, the rc script runs local-unbound-setup to generate one.
Note that these scripts place the unbound configuration files in /var/unbound rather than /etc/unbound. This is necessary so that unbound can reload its configuration while chrooted. We should probably provide symlinks in /etc.
Approved by: re (blanket)
|
#
250968 |
|
24-May-2013 |
jamie |
Mention the "nojailvnet" keyword.
MFC after: 3 days
|
#
235873 |
|
24-May-2012 |
wblock |
Fixes to man8 groff mandoc style, usage mistakes, or typos.
PR: 168016 Submitted by: Nobuyuki Koganemaru Approved by: gjb MFC after: 3 days
|
#
235441 |
|
14-May-2012 |
gjb |
Fix an mdoc(7) formatting nit.
|
#
230116 |
|
14-Jan-2012 |
dougb |
Remove documentation for set_rcvar() now that it has been removed.
|
#
213573 |
|
08-Oct-2010 |
uqs |
mdoc: drop redundant .Pp and .LP calls
They have no effect when coming in pairs, or before .Bl/.Bd
|
#
199463 |
|
17-Nov-2009 |
delphij |
rc.early(8) was removed as of 20090530 so remove manual page reference to it.
MFC after: 1 week
|
#
171562 |
|
24-Jul-2007 |
delphij |
Stop mentioning /usr/X11R6.
Approved by: re (hrs)
|
#
169668 |
|
18-May-2007 |
mtm |
o Implement the stop_boot subroutine [1]. This subroutine can be used by scripts in rc.d to stop rc(8) from booting into multi-user mode when a critical or severe error condition is encountered.
o Modify scripts in etc/rc.d that already implemented this functionality independently.
o Document it.
[1] - This subroutine was implemented in FreeBSD in rc.d/fsck. I moved it to rc.subr(8). Our version differs slightly in that it takes an optional argument to stop the boot even if "autoboot" is not set.
Obtained from: NetBSD MFC after: 2 weeks
|
#
162404 |
|
18-Sep-2006 |
ru |
Markup fixes.
|
#
153534 |
|
19-Dec-2005 |
dougb |
Bring this page of the manual more in line with reality as to how things work currently.
Delete a lot of stale references.
|
#
140573 |
|
21-Jan-2005 |
ru |
Fixed xref.
|
#
140561 |
|
21-Jan-2005 |
ru |
Sort sections.
|
#
136228 |
|
07-Oct-2004 |
mtm |
Forced commit:
Remove references to the FreeBSD keyword. Make a note in UPDATING about the recent change regarding the keyword.
MFC after: 3 days
|
#
136225 |
|
07-Oct-2004 |
mtm |
F
|
#
131754 |
|
07-Jul-2004 |
ru |
mdoc(7) fixes.
|
#
131594 |
|
04-Jul-2004 |
ru |
Sort SEE ALSO references (in dictionary order, ignoring case).
|
#
131538 |
|
03-Jul-2004 |
imp |
Document /var/run/dmesg.boot, which is created by the rc scripts. Many people have suggested that we document this somewhere, and this was a common suggestion.
|
#
107788 |
|
12-Dec-2002 |
ru |
Uniformly refer to a file system as "file system".
Approved by: re
|
#
107383 |
|
29-Nov-2002 |
ru |
mdoc(7) police: scheduled sweep.
Approved by: re
|
#
107143 |
|
21-Nov-2002 |
gordon |
Update rc(8) manpage to reflect rc.d Add an rc.subr(8) manpage Hook rc.subr.8 up to the build.
Submitted by: Mike Makonnen <mtm@identd.net> Approved by: re@ (bmah) Obtained from: NetBSD
|
#
102182 |
|
20-Aug-2002 |
schweikh |
Insert missing 'are' to fix grammar bogon. MFC after: 3 days
|
#
99969 |
|
14-Jul-2002 |
charnier |
The .Nm utility
|
#
92778 |
|
20-Mar-2002 |
cjc |
Add a paragraph break I missed in my last update.
|
#
92486 |
|
17-Mar-2002 |
cjc |
Add documentation for rc.early(8).
PR: misc/35992 MFC after: 3 days
|
#
81285 |
|
08-Aug-2001 |
ru |
mdoc(7) police: expand plain text xrefs.
|
#
79727 |
|
14-Jul-2001 |
schweikh |
Removed whitespace at end-of-line; no content changes. I simply did cd src/share; find man[1-9] -type f|xargs perl -pi -e 's/[ \t]+$//'
BTW, what editors are the culprits? I'm using vim and it shows me whitespace at EOL in troff files with a thick blue block...
Reviewed by: Silence from cvs diff -b MFC after: 7 days
|
#
79538 |
|
10-Jul-2001 |
ru |
mdoc(7) police: removed HISTORY info from the .Os call.
|
#
68962 |
|
20-Nov-2000 |
ru |
mdoc(7) police: use the new features of the Nm macro.
|
#
63547 |
|
19-Jul-2000 |
ben |
Document the rc.d system.
Suggested by: dcs Reviewed by: alex, dcs, sheldonh
|
#
61855 |
|
20-Jun-2000 |
alex |
rc.local is no longer a default.
PR: 19314 Submitted by: Ben Smithurst <ben@scientia.demon.co.uk>
|
#
57731 |
|
03-Mar-2000 |
sheldonh |
Remove single-space hard sentence breaks. These degrade the quality of the typeset output, tend to make diffs harder to read and provide bad examples for new-comers to mdoc.
|
#
50476 |
|
27-Aug-1999 |
peter |
$Id$ -> $FreeBSD$
|
#
41707 |
|
12-Dec-1998 |
dillon |
Reviewed by: freebsd-current
Update manual pages for rc(8) and rc.conf(5) based on recent changes to rc.local and rc.conf[.local].
|
#
41706 |
|
12-Dec-1998 |
dillon |
Clarify rc's handling of rc.local
|
#
40006 |
|
06-Oct-1998 |
phk |
Here are some scripts and man pages for configuring HARP ATM interfaces.
Reviewed by: phk Submitted by: Mike Spengler <mks@networkcs.com>
|
#
33839 |
|
26-Feb-1998 |
jkh |
Update man page to reflect reality. PR: 5828 Submitted by: Stephen J. Roznowski <sjr@home.net>
|
#
23466 |
|
07-Mar-1997 |
jmg |
add missing cvs Id lines.
|
#
15135 |
|
08-Apr-1996 |
mpp |
Correct some man page xrefs, and some other minor changes to bring some man pages up to mdoc guidelines and fix some minor formatting glitches. Also fixed a number of man pages to not abuse the .Xr macro to display functions and path names and a lot of other junk.
|
#
1639 |
|
30-May-1994 |
rgrimes |
This commit was generated by cvs2svn to compensate for changes in r1638, which included commits to RCS files with non-trunk default branches.
|
#
1638 |
|
30-May-1994 |
rgrimes |
BSD 4.4 Lite Share Sources
|